Automatyzacja konfigurowania klienta programu MTS w celu korzystania ze sk│adnik≤w zdalnych

Aby skonfigurowaµ klienta do korzystania ze sk│adnika zdalnego Bank.CreateTable:

  1. Zadeklaruj obiekty, kt≤re bΩd╣ wykorzystywane podczas konfigurowania klienta (korzystaj╣cego z programu MTS) dla potrzeb uruchamiania sk│adnik≤w zdalnych.
    Dim catalog As Object
    Dim remoteComps As Object
    Dim util As Object
  2. Za pomoc╣ polecenia On Error obs│u┐ b│Ωdy czasu wykonywania, otrzymywane w razie zwrotu przez metodΩ awaryjnej warto£ci HRESULT. Polecenie On Error i obiekt Err pozwalaj╣ sprawdziµ b│Ωdy oraz odpowiednio na nie zareagowaµ.
    On Error GoTo failed
  3. Wywo│aj metodΩ CreateObject, aby utworzyµ instancjΩ obiektu Catalog. Wywo│uj╣c metodΩ GetCollection pobierz kolekcjΩ RemoteComponents. NastΩpnie za pomoc╣ metody GetUtilInterface utw≤rz instancjΩ obiektu RemoteComponentUtil. Aby zainstalowaµ sk│adnik zdalny, wywo│aj metodΩ InstallRemoteComponentByName, a nastΩpnie podaj nazwΩ komputera serwera, nazwΩ pakietu na serwerze i nazwΩ sk│adnika.
    Set catalog = CreateObject("MTSAdmin.Catalog.1")
    Set remoteComps = catalog.GetCollection("RemoteComponents")
    Set util = remoteComps.GetUtilInterface
    	util.InstallRemoteComponentByName "remote1", "New","Bank.CreateTable"
    Exit Sub
  4. W razie nieudanej instalacji pakietu wy£wietlaj komunikat o b│Ωdzie. W komunikacie wykorzystaj obiekt Err.
    	failed:
        MsgBox "Failure code " + Str$(Err.Number)
    
    	End Sub

Zobacz te┐

Obiekty administracyjne programu MTS, Typy kolekcji programu MTS, Metody obiekt≤w administracyjnych programu MTS, Automatyzacja czynno£ci administracyjnych programu MTS za pomoc╣ programu Visual Basic


© 1998 Microsoft Corporation. Wszelkie prawa zastrze┐one.